What is an Accident Injury Law Firm?
An accident injury law firm specializes in representing people who have been hurt due to somebody else's carelessness. This can include numerous kinds of accidents, such as:
- Vehicular Accidents: Car, motorbike, truck, and pedestrian accidents.
- Office Injuries: Injuries sustained on the jobsite.
- Slip and Fall Accidents: Injuries arising from dangerous conditions on another's home.
- Item Liability: Injuries brought on by defective or harmful products.
- Medical Malpractice: Injuries due to neglect by healthcare specialists.

Actions to Take After an Accident
If you find yourself associated with an accident, following these steps can help secure your rights and prepare for potential legal action:
Seek Medical Attention: Prioritize your health and wellness by getting treatment immediately.
Document the Scene: Take pictures of the accident scene, collect witness names and contact details, and gather any available evidence.
Contact Authorities: Report the accident to police to develop a main record.
Notify Your Insurance: Inform your insurer about the accident. Be mindful when going over details; stay with the truths.
Talk to a Law Firm: Reach out to an accident injury law firm to discuss your case and understand your legal choices.
Typical Types of Compensation Available
Victims of accidents might be entitled to various types of compensation, which can consist of:
| Type of Compensation | Description |
|---|---|
| Medical Expenses | Covers hospital bills, rehabilitation expenses, and continuous treatment. |
| Lost Wages | Compensates for income lost due to inability to work following the accident. |
| Residential or commercial property Damage | Compensates the expense of repairing or changing harmed property. |
| Pain and Suffering | Compensates for physical discomfort and psychological distress brought on by the accident. |
| Compensatory damages | Awarded in cases of gross negligence to punish the defendant. |
FAQs About Accident Injury Law Firms
1. How do I select the best accident injury law practice?
When picking a law office, consider their experience, medical history, client reviews, and whether they offer a totally free initial assessment. It's likewise crucial to feel comfortable with the attorney you choose.
2. How much does it cost to employ an accident injury lawyer?
A lot of law office deal with a contingency charge basis, indicating you just pay if you win your case. Usually, the charge varies from 25% to 40% of the settlement.
3. The length of time do I need to submit a claim after an accident?
Statute of constraints differs by state however generally ranges from 1 to 3 years. It's necessary to act quickly to ensure you don't miss your opportunity to look for compensation.
4. What if my case does not go to trial?
Lots of cases settle before reaching trial. An experienced law office will work out in your place to protect a reasonable settlement without the requirement for court appearances.
5. Will I need to go to court?
Not always. Numerous cases are settled out of court through settlements. Nevertheless, if a fair settlement can not be reached, your lawyer will be prepared to take your case to trial.
